Job description
Data Curation Information Model Developer

This role focuses on organizing and structuring scientific data to make it easy for R&D teams to find, use, and understand. Data governance and transparent ownership are integrated into the process. We are seeking someone with hands‑on experience in curating and managing data who also understands how data can be connected and standardized using ontologies and semantic principles.

In the short term, the role will primarily focus on clinical trial design data, with an eventual expansion into other types of scientific data such as clinical trial patient data, real‑world data, molecular data, and more. The goal is to create clear and consistent data models based on existing standards that address the needs of R&D while supporting integration into the workflows of various stakeholders. Your work will ensure that data is well‑structured and fit‑for‑purpose, empowering teams to focus on their science and decision‑making.

In this role you will
  • Create and maintain scientific data information models.
  • Advise on implementation of data information models in a clinical trial context.
  • Develop and implement a vision and strategy to create and govern scientific data information models to enable storage and accessibility in alignment with the R&D Data Platforms.
  • Ensure alignment of governance and data management practice by partnering with enterprise‑wide information and data architects, ontology management, data governance groups.
  • Partner strongly with the R&D Tech teams and deliver use‑cases to address deficiencies and opportunities that exist to further modernise clinical, RWD and bioinformatics data information models.
  • Represent the organization in industry forums and collaborate with external partners to advance data information‑modelling practices.

Basic Qualifications & Skills
  • BS/MSc/PhD (or equivalent) in Information Science, Bioinformatics, Computer Science, or a related subject.
  • Hands‑on experience in curating and managing data (e.g., consolidating data from spreadsheets, databases, or raw files into a centralized repository).
  • Understanding of data information modelling and governance principles and practices.
  • Agile mindset, the ability to iterate improvements based on stakeholder feedback.
  • Deep expertise of clinical data and information models such as USDM, HL7‑FHIR, OMOP(CDM), CDISC (ODM: CDASH, SDTM, ADaM) and other industry standards.
  • Deep expertise in clinical data regulations, processes and interfaces.
  • Experience driving change in a large global organization.
Preferred Qualifications & Skills
  • Experience in developing taxonomies and ontologies is an advantage.
  • Experience developing standards through participation in cross‑industry working groups.
